abolition the call to outlaw slavery
antebellum before the 'war' in the South
gag rule prevented debate on the slave issue
Nat Turner a slave preacher who led a slave revolt killing nearly 60 whites
Frederick Douglass an escaped slave that became a well respected speaker that worked to outlaw slavery
William Lloyd Garrison editor of the 'Liberator' an abolitionist paper from Boston
The North Star a anti-slavery newspaper published by Frederick Douglass
I will be heard Finishes the quote by Garrison, "I am in ernest---I will not equivocate---I will not excuse---I will not retreat a single inch---and ___ ___ ___ ____.
emancipation the freeing of the slaves with no payment to slaveholders.
